Fix it or part it?
I have a 1993 190E 2.6. Presently it has the following issues:
1. Automatice Transmittion - Reverse gear is bad. Will not back up on a slope and barely on flat surface. Forward gears are ok.
2. Engine - suspect timing has jumped. Gets gas and spark. Will not fire up.
3. Heater Core - needs to be replaced. Lot of work to remove dashboard.
She is gray, has a hit on the driver side fender. Has new tires and struts / shocks. Drives great.
What should I do, repair it or let her go? It may cost upwards of over $2000 to fix, but when fixed she may be worth it.
